Get a Free Vending Machine Quote!

Random Listing

29 Mayfair Industrial Estate

Latchingdon, Chelmsford, Essex

11a Bilbrook Road, Bilbrook, Codsall

Wolverhampton, West Midlands

564 Toller La, Heaton

Bradford, West Yorkshire

43 Cheapside Chambers

Bradford, West Yorkshire

4 Poplar Road

Glenrothes, Fife

Vending Machines Businesses in Worcestershire

Below is a list of vending machines located in Worcestershire, UK, serving cities such as Worcester, and more. Click on a city name for full listings